Transaction 55582fa991697d1971da916211a4a59072ff8176122f3d28be079f73374f1cfa

1 Input
2 Outputs
  • 55582fa991697d1971da916211a4a59072ff8176122f3d28be079f73374f1cfa:0
  • value  650000000
    address  17fRttDzRDwfwqz4SbBjcfaZ4Kfc142tUg
  • 55582fa991697d1971da916211a4a59072ff8176122f3d28be079f73374f1cfa:1
  • value  83717090
    address  153X5sE89WgQvudLGR2UVtqUsrx9HbD8fh